Transaction 890a89608dd491ef2861f63b76c92d0dbb34dc33f9a6a881142a709c37ae6d5b
1 Input
1 Output
-
890a89608dd491ef2861f63b76c92d0dbb34dc33f9a6a881142a709c37ae6d5b:0
- value
- 1500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ed2ec72994300ff30902fd4b9e6d65f9cf89605ea7253f2c255207e572dd9a18
- address
- tb1pa5hvw2v5xq8lxzgzl49eumt9l88cjcz75ujn7tp92gr72ukangvqvaxlfj